Blue whales increase feeding rates at fine-scale ocean features

Summary

Blue whales consistently forage in dynamic ocean features, demonstrating a strong link between submesoscale currents and feeding hot spots. This highlights the importance of these features for blue whale foraging success and habitat conservation.
